English grammar is serious stuff, and there's only so much that can be done to make it entertaining. But the Standard Deviants, an energetic troupe of young performers whose specialty is making serious academic subjects engaging, happily dive into what they call "The Split-Infinitive World of English Grammar." The lessons on this DVD have been prepared by a panel of serious academics, but flashy graphics abound. And the performers do their best to liven up presentations of basic concepts. Nouns, verbs, adjectives, and other parts of speech are explained with some offbeat examples (for instance, a film of a lizard is used to demonstrate why "gecko" is a common noun). While introducing a section on verbals, a young woman mentions that a "funky thing" verbs can do is function as other parts of speech. Eventually all parts of speech are covered, and basic sentence structures are introduced. At the end of each set of lessons a quiz is presented, which a student can either take or skip. After proceeding through all the lessons on this DVD (which contains about two hours worth of material), a student can take the "Gram Slam," a comprehensive exam. English grammar will never be a barrel of fun, but the Standard Deviants deserve credit for making this review course as engaging as the subject is ever likely to get. --Robert J. McNamara

Good for Review of the Basics of Grammar
This DVD takes you at a rapid speed through the basics of grammar. There are three more DVDs in this series that deal with grammar and punctuation.
The DVD may be best used perhaps for a review of grammar -
to brush up on what you know.
If you're starting from scratch,
it may also been a solid introduction - getting acquainted with
the elements of grammar. If words like "adverbs" or "adjectives" sound like mystical language to you - they will be demystified here.
On the other hand, if you're struggling with conjugating irregular verbs, you'll still have to pick a good grammar book and to memorize the verbs you don't know.
And, as a matter of fact, this DVD is best used in conjunction with a good grammar book. DVD only helps to learn and memorize areas of grammar faster, but it does not replace the need to work separately on the areas that may be challenging for you.
